#54a39d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54a39d is composed of 32.9% red, 63.9%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.7%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 175.4 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 48.4%. #54a39d color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#00473b.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#54a39d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040807 is the darkest color, while #fafc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#54a39d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7d7d is the less saturated color, while #08efdd is the most saturated one.
